WebDec 23, 2024 · The resistor in parallel with the photodiode is called the shunt resistance (R SH). As with current sources in general, ideal operation is achieved when R SH is infinite. With infinite (or, in real life, extremely high) shunt resistance, a current source delivers all of its current to the load, and the current-to-voltage ratio is determined ... At steady state there is no current through the resistor so you get a simple voltage divider vo … WebApr 2, 2024 · Basic electrical knowledge: two devices in parallel always experience the same voltage drop. If you connect a diode and a resistor in parallel, their forward voltages must be the same. And since the diode has a pretty much fixed forward voltage, this is the forward voltage that they both will have. WebFigure 2 shows a simple current divider made up of a capacitor and a resistor.
